What this company does

Tenable sells and markets its enterprise platform offerings through its sales force, which works closely with channel partners that include a network of distributors and resellers. Tenable One is an AI-powered exposure management platform that gives enterprises a single, unified view of risk across all types of assets and attack pathways. Tenable Vulnerability Management is its cloud-delivered software-as-a-service offering that provides organizations with a risk-based view of traditional and modern attack surfaces. At December 31, 2025, it had over 40,000 customers, including approximately 65% of the Fortune 500 and approximately 50% of the Global 2000. In 2025, 2024 and 2023, no single customer represented more than 2% of its revenue. At December 31, 2025, it had 1,995 employees, including 949 located outside of the United States. Tenable Network Security, Inc., its predecessor, was incorporated under the laws of the State of Delaware in 2002, and Tenable Holdings, Inc. was incorporated in Delaware in October 2015.
